Ingredients


– 1 pound large sea scallops
– 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
– 3 cloves garlic, minced
– Juice and zest of 1 lemon
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ating mouth-watering Seared Scallops in Lemon Garlic Butter is easy when you follow these straightforward steps:
1. Pat Dry the Scallops: Use paper towels to thoroughly dry the scallops. This is essential for achieving a good sear.
2. Season Scallops: Sprinkle salt and pepper generously on both sides of the scallops.
3. Heat the Pan: In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of butter over medium-high heat until melted and bubbly.
4. Sear the Scallops: Place the scallops in the skillet, ensuring not to overcrowd the pan. C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own. Flip them carefully to ensure they remain intact.
5. Make the Sauce: Once the scallops are seared, remove them from the skillet and set aside. In the same pan, add the remaining tablespoon of butter, minced garlic, lemon juice, and zest. Stir for about a minute until fragrant.
6. Combine: Return the scallops to the pan and toss them in the lemon garlic butter sauce for a minute to coat.
7. Garnish and Serve: Plate the scallops, spoon extra sauce over the top, and garnish with fresh parsley.

Additional Tips


– Choose the Right Scallops: For the best flavor, opt for fresh, dry-packed scallops rather than those soaked in a chemical solution.
– Use High Heat: Searing is all about achieving that perfect golden crust, so ensure your skillet is hot enough before adding the scallops.
– Don’t Overcrowd the Pan: This allows for even cooking and prevents steaming. Sear in batches if necessary.
– Let the Scallops Rest: Allowing the scallops to rest for a few minutes after cooking helps maintain their tenderness.
– Experiment with Finishing Oils: After plating, drizzle with high-quality olive oil or a flavored oil for an extra layer of flavor.

Recipe Variation


Feel free to get creative with Seared Scallops in Lemon Garlic Butter! Here are a few exciting variations to try:
1. Herb-Infused Butter: Add fresh herbs, like thyme or rosemary, to the butter for added depth of flavor.
2. Citrus Twist: Try using lime or orange juice instead of lemon for a different citrus profile.
3. Spicy Kick: Incorporate red pepper flakes or a splash of hot sauce to the garlic butter for some heat.
4. Creamy Texture: For a creamier sauce, add a splash of heavy cream when making the lemon garlic sauce.
5. Pair with Vegetable Purees: Serve the scallops atop a bed of pureed vegetables, like butternut squash or pea puree, for a beautiful presentation.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Store leftover scallops in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
Freezing: For best results, avoid freezing cooked scallops. However, if needed, freeze them in an airtight container for up to 1 month. Thaw in the refrigerator before reheating gently in a pan to avoid overcooking.

Frequently Asked Questions


How do I know when my scallops are done cooking?
Scallops should be opaque and firm to the touch. They usually take 2-3 minutes per side to sear perfectly.
Can I use frozen scallops for this recipe?
Yes, but ensure they are thoroughly thawed and patted dry before cooking for optimal searing.
What can I substitute for scallops?
If you’re looking for an alternative, consider using shrimp or monkfish, which have a similar texture.
Can I make the lemon garlic butter sauce 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the sauce in advance and reheat it when ready to serve with the seared scallops.
Is this dish suitable for meal prepping?
While scallops are best enjoyed fresh, you can prep the ingredients and sear them right before serving for freshness.
